20). Scrip Fundraising - Quick Tips By : Kimberly Reynolds
Scrip fundraising offers non-profit organizations the opportunity to raise funds without asking anyone to spend a penny more than they already do.
Scrip is currently used to raise funds by private and public schools, religious organizations, service organizations, sports and athletic clubs, charities and childcare centers.
Instead of asking people to spend additional money on items they may not want or need, scrip enables people to help your fundraising efforts while they make their normal purchases.

23). Pizza Fundraiser Ideas By : Kimberly Reynolds
Fundraising with pizza is a great idea for most any size group. It provides your buyers with something everyone wants, and can be very profitable as a fundraising idea.
There are three different types of pizza fundraisers:
Sales of pizza by the slice
Sales of pizza fundraising discount cards
Sales of pizza supplies - make your own kits
Each of these fundraisers varies in effort, requirements, and profitability.

24). Silicone Wristbands: Fad, Fashion, or Mainstay? By : Clark A. Swihart
Awareness Bracelet Craze
Ever since Lance Armstrong started the silicone wristband craze with the release of his yellow “LIVESTRONG” wristbands, millions of people worldwide have discovered a new and effective method of supporting their favorite causes. Today, there is almost every color imaginable to be found on these ubiquitous silicone bracelets; each one performing their part in raising awareness for a multitude of diseases and causes.
